Location
Kings Reach is accessed via a grand lobby and from this particular apartment there are far reaching views across the
town.
Situated in the heart of the town centre, overlooking the River Kennet. A short walk from the property brings you to the Oracle Centre, here major stores can be found together with specialist retailers. Reading is known for its annual music festival and has a vibrant entertainment scene all year round.
Reading is also a great centre of learning, from its famous University to many top scoring OFSTED schools. When it comes to unwinding, long walks or cycle rides along the Thames path are a perfect way to spend a Sunday, and nothing can beat a long summer's day around Caversham Lakes, home to prestigious rowing and sailing clubs.
Nestled in the Berkshire countryside, Reading is surrounded by green spaces, so whichever way you choose to explore the local area, you really are spoiled for choice. The transformation of Reading will make it an ever more popular choice for commuters into London. It's less than half an hour into Paddington, one of London's best connected Stations.
